Low maintenance, quiet, stress-free

The heart of the setup is the Gates belt drive combined with a Shimano Alfine hub gear system. No oil, no dirt, no chain rattling—just pedal and ride. This is a huge advantage, especially in everyday life: less maintenance, less wear and tear, more time on the bike.
And if you do happen to be on the road for longer periods of time, the system continues to run just as smoothly and reliably.

Lights on, mind clear

With its built-in SON lighting system, including Edelux II front light and rear light on the luggage rack, this veloheld.lane is always ready to go. Power is reliably supplied by the hub dynamo, whether on dark winter mornings or on the late ride home after work. You don’t have to switch it on, recharge it, or even think about it—the light just works, always.

Added to this is the front luggage rack, which makes the bike extremely versatile: work bags, shopping, or weekend luggage can be transported with ease without affecting the riding experience.
Sturdy mudguards, a Hebie kickstand, and grippy Schwalbe Tour and City tires with reflective strips ensure that the veloheld.lane is just as impressive in everyday use as it is on longer journeys or short detours off the asphalt. The setup is rounded off by the SON, Shimano, and Radiale wheelset, which delivers exactly what you want: smooth running, stability, and durability. No show, no frills—just solid reliability, mile after mile.
